Banish the Poolside Jitters  

 

 

 

It's probably fairly safe to assume that you'll be looking at going to the pool or the beach or a backyard BBQ/pool party at some point this summer.  And if you're like most of us, most of us women at least, it's also fairly safe to assume that you'll experience a degree of angst in deciding what to wear.  Even the most confident of women seems to get an attack of the nerves when it comes to this subject.  Let's banish those jitters right now with a few confidence-building tips!   

 

First of all, if you're in the market for a new swimsuit and/or cover-up...  (and if you haven't taken stock of your suit(s) and cover-ups from last year, now would be a good time to do it, while there are still some choices left in the stores), you obviously want to pick a suit that will bring out your inherent beauty. 

To do that, take a look in your closet and make note of the predominant colors, and which of those colors generate the most compliments when you wear them.  Those are good colors to remember and focus on when you get to the store. To even the most veteran of shoppers it can sometimes be overwhelming,  seeing all the racks of suits and cover-ups in every color and print imaginable. Making notes ahead of time about the colors you are focusing on can make the process less confusing. 

Besides those colors that get you compliments, focus on prints or colors that complement your eye, skin or hair colors.  These are colors that will instantly make you feel more attractive.

Speaking of prints
, give yourself permission to wear a bold print; if not in your suit, then try one in a cute cover-up or sundress. There are always lots of florals available, but maybe you'll find one in a great graphic or animal print. If you opt for a print swimsuit, many of these can double for casual dining, just by tossing on a pareo or long skirt.  Solid colors can be very elegant, but it's also fun to have a print just to mix things up.  Let yourself think outside the box!





Cover-ups do double-duty
. While they serve their basic purpose when worn over your suit, they also work beautifully if you have no intention of going in the pool, or when you're ready to transition from pool-time to dinner-time. Wear one over white jeans or capris and you're instantly festive.

Make a bold move. 
If you're opting for a neutral palette, add one colorful, bold accessory.  Maybe it's a hat, or a gauzy scarf (check out this animated tutorial on 5 ways to tie scarves for the summer), or some embellished or metallic sandals or wedges.


Finish Your Look
.  Don't forget the little extra's that will make you look movie-star glamorous.  Oversized sunglasses and a tote give you presence.  Maybe try a dramatic, colored pair of sunglasses for a change of pace.




Add in a few body-wise moves
that will help you look like you've been on a cruise, even if it's your first day out in the sun for the past few months. Most of us don't have flawless skin, but it's amazing what a (fake) tan and a bit of shimmer can do to conceal and even-out the rough and discolored areas that, unfortunately, just tend to pop up over the years.

The first step is a spray tan, whether self-applied or professionally done.  My favorite professional spray tan is the VersaSpa - it doesn't have an odd smell and it dries evenly.  You'll want to schedule this a couple of days prior to your event so the tan has time to develop.  For a self-applied product, friends recommend Fake Bake - I haven't tried it yet but from what I've seen it gives a beautiful, even glow.  I've also recently been using a daily lotion with tanner from Jergens that I just love (especially the price!) It helps you maintain a nice even color, with no icky odor.  (I've put together a few of my favorite summer products below in case you'd like to check them out.)

Add a bit of shimmer to the outside of your arms, on the front of your legs, perhaps your collarbone or decolletage...a bit of sheen is slimming and glamorous. (Don't go overboard, though - you don't want to look like a swimsuit model - well, maybe you do - but you want to glow, not shine!)
